Market Segmentation Analysis

The Hydrogen IC Engines Market is segmented by Blending (Mix Blend, and Pure Hydrogen), by State (Gas, and Liquid), by Power rating (Low, Medium, and High), by Application (Transportation and Power Generation), and by Region (North America [The USA, Canada, Mexico, and Rest of North America], Europe [Germany, France, Italy, The UK, and Rest of Europe], Asia-Pacific [China, Japan, India, and Rest of Asia-Pacific], and Rest of the World [South America, Middle East & Africa]).

Mix Blend and Pure Hydrogen are the stated blending segments. Mix Blend type is anticipated to hold the largest share during the forecast years, which places transitional fuel strategies at the center of near-term hydrogen combustion adoption.

Gas and Liquid are the stated state segments. Liquid is expected to register the highest CAGR during the forecast period due to superior energy density and storage efficiency, strengthening its commercial role in demanding applications.

Transportation and Power Generation are the stated application segments. Transportation is anticipated to be the largest segment because of demand for cleaner fuel substitutes for conventional engines in heavy-duty trucks, off-road equipment, and commercial vehicles.

Low, Medium & High are the stated power rating segments. Medium Power rating is leading because of increasing demand for sustainable fuel sources, showing how practical engine capacity requirements are shaping hydrogen IC engine adoption.

Regional Market Insights

North America is expected to be the dominant and fastest-growing region over the forecasted period. Strategic alliances and investments, especially involving the United States and Canada, are supporting hydrogen IC engine technology development and market expansion.

Emerging Trends Shaping the Hydrogen IC Engines Market

A major trend is the emergence of hydrogen combustion as a competitive pathway beside other clean powertrain options. The source highlights that H2-ICEs retain traditional engine structure, allowing manufacturers to adapt platforms with fewer changes than switching to fuel cells or electric drivetrains.

Another trend is product-development activity among key industry participants. The source notes Cummins’ acquisition of Meritor and MAN Energy Solutions’ hydrogen-fueled medium-speed engine collaboration for maritime applications, reflecting company-level movement around integrated powertrain and hydrogen engine concepts.

The market outlook also reflects increasing attention to challenges. Safety concerns, strict hydrogen fuelling protocols, specialized storage systems, compression, liquefaction, and distribution networks remain important factors that can shape competitive execution and investment strategy.
